The Advancements In Non-Invasive DNA Testing: A Game Changer

In recent years, non-invasive DNA testing has been gaining more and more attention for its groundbreaking potential in various fields such as healthcare, forensic science, and ancestry research This cutting-edge technology allows scientists to analyze an individual’s DNA without the need for invasive procedures like drawing blood Instead, samples can be obtained from sources such as saliva, hair follicles, or even skin cells left behind on objects touched by the person This non-invasive approach has revolutionized the way DNA analysis is conducted, offering a more comfortable and convenient option for individuals seeking genetic information.

Non-invasive DNA testing has opened up new possibilities in the field of healthcare Traditionally, genetic testing required blood samples to be drawn and sent to a laboratory for analysis This process could be time-consuming, costly, and uncomfortable for patients With non-invasive DNA testing, individuals can provide a saliva sample in the comfort of their own homes and send it off for analysis This method is not only more convenient but also less stressful for patients, making it easier for individuals to access important genetic information about their health.

One of the most significant advancements in non-invasive DNA testing is in the field of prenatal screening Previously, pregnant women seeking genetic testing for their unborn child would have to undergo invasive procedures such as amniocentesis or chorionic villus sampling These procedures carry a risk of complications and can be uncomfortable for the mother Non-invasive prenatal testing (NIPT) now allows for the screening of fetal DNA in the mother’s blood, offering a safer and more accurate option for detecting genetic abnormalities such as Down syndrome This breakthrough has transformed the landscape of prenatal care, providing expectant mothers with valuable information about their baby’s health without the need for invasive procedures.

Ancestry research has also been transformed by the advent of non-invasive DNA testing Individuals seeking to learn more about their heritage can now provide a saliva sample and receive detailed information about their genetic ancestry This has enabled people to connect with long-lost relatives, uncover family history, and trace their roots back through generations The ease and accessibility of non-invasive DNA testing have made genetic genealogy more popular and widespread, allowing individuals from all walks of life to explore their genetic heritage in a meaningful way.

The rise of non-invasive DNA testing has not come without challenges and ethical considerations As the technology becomes more advanced and accessible, questions have arisen about the privacy and security of genetic information Concerns about data breaches and unauthorized use of DNA data have prompted calls for stronger regulations and safeguards to protect individuals’ genetic privacy Additionally, the implications of genetic testing in terms of discrimination, insurance coverage, and personal autonomy remain important ethical considerations that must be carefully addressed as non-invasive DNA testing continues to evolve.
